Common Name7''-ethyl-6-methyl-4'',7''-dihydro-3''h-dispiro[oxane-2,6'-[7,9,12]triazatricyclo[6.3.1.0⁴,¹²]dodecane-10',2''-oxepin]-7'-ene
Description7''-Ethyl-6-methyl-4'',7''-dihydro-3''H-dispiro[oxane-2,6'-[7,9,12]triazatricyclo[6.3.1.0⁴,¹²]Dodecane-10',2''-oxepin]-7'-ene belongs to the class of organic compounds known as hydropyrimidines. Hydropyrimidines are compounds containing a hydrogenated pyrimidine ring (i.E. Containing less than the maximum number of double bonds.). 7''-ethyl-6-methyl-4'',7''-dihydro-3''h-dispiro[oxane-2,6'-[7,9,12]triazatricyclo[6.3.1.0⁴,¹²]dodecane-10',2''-oxepin]-7'-ene is found in Monanchora unguiculata. 7''-Ethyl-6-methyl-4'',7''-dihydro-3''H-dispiro[oxane-2,6'-[7,9,12]triazatricyclo[6.3.1.0⁴,¹²]Dodecane-10',2''-oxepin]-7'-ene is a very strong basic compound (based on its pKa).
